?Are you ready to make your LearnWorlds site look and feel exactly like your brand so learners never see the platform behind the experience?
LearnWorlds White Label And Branding: Full Customization Tips
You can transform LearnWorlds into a seamless extension of your brand with the right white-labeling and branding strategies. This article guides you through every customization option, practical steps, and best practices so you control appearance, user experience, and perception from sign-up to certification.
Why white labeling matters for your online school
White labeling ensures the platform looks like your product rather than a supplier’s solution. When learners see consistent branding, you increase trust, conversions, and perceived value. Clear branding also lets you package courses as proprietary products which supports pricing, partnerships, and marketing.
What you can achieve with LearnWorlds white label
You can remove LearnWorlds logos, use your own domain, customize emails and certificates, tweak the course player, and apply CSS/JS for refined control. These changes let you present a polished, enterprise-grade learning environment that matches other customer touchpoints like your website and apps.
LearnWorlds white label fundamentals
Start with the essentials that make your school appear native to your brand. These foundational elements are critical for consistent user experience and should be prioritized early in any customization process.
Use a custom domain
A custom domain (e.g., academy.yourdomain.com) is the first step toward a branded experience. When you use your domain, all URLs display your brand and learners find it more credible.
- You will need to add DNS records at your domain registrar.
- LearnWorlds supports both CNAME and A records depending on the configuration.
- Enable HTTPS so your site displays the padlock and avoids browser warnings.
Remove LearnWorlds branding
Removing platform logos and default footers prevents learners from recognizing LearnWorlds as the platform provider. Check plan limitations first, because some LearnWorlds plans restrict white-label capabilities.
- Replace platform logos with your own in header and footer.
- Customize or remove footer text and platform badges.
- Edit course player branding and certificates to feature your branding.
SSL and secure access
SSL is required for trust and for integrations like payment gateways. LearnWorlds can provide SSL via Let’s Encrypt or allow you to use your own certificates depending on your setup and domain.
- Confirm automatic SSL issuance after domain propagation.
- Check mixed-content issues if you embed external scripts or assets.
- Use HSTS to enforce secure connections across your domain.
Account-level branding settings
These settings control global aspects of appearance and consistent application across pages. Setting them correctly once saves time and ensures uniformity.
Uploading logos and icons
You will typically upload multiple images for different contexts: header logo, mobile logo, favicon, and certificate logos.
- Use optimized SVGs or PNGs to preserve quality and loading performance.
- Maintain consistent aspect ratios to prevent layout shifts.
- Keep a monochrome or simplified version for small sizes.
Setting brand colors and fonts
Brand colors and typefaces unify your design. Choose a primary color for actions and accents and secondary colors for backgrounds and borders.
- Apply fonts via LearnWorlds settings or by adding custom font files/CSS.
- Consider accessibility for color contrast and font size.
- Document color hex codes and font stacks in a branding guide for future reference.
Header and footer customization
The header and footer are seen on every page and must reflect your navigation and legal requirements.
- Include concise navigation, search, and account actions in the header.
- Use footer space for contact, privacy policy, terms, and company information.
- Add social links and a short copyright statement.
Course player and learning experience branding
You control how learners interact with courses and consume content. The course player is central to your product experience.
Customizing the course player appearance
You can adjust player colors, button styles, and header controls to match your brand. This affects playtime controls, progress bars, and video overlays.
- Match call-to-action button colors to your primary brand color.
- Customize progress bars so they are visible on both light and dark backgrounds.
- Test player controls on mobile to ensure touch targets are usable.
Adding custom CSS and JavaScript
For more precise control, add CSS and JavaScript to override default styles and add new interactive behaviors.
- Use CSS variables or well-scoped selectors to avoid breaking future updates.
- Minimize JS usage to maintain performance and avoid conflicts with LearnWorlds scripts.
- Store custom code in a version-controlled place to revert changes if needed.
Layout templates and content blocks
You can create or customize templates for course pages, sales pages, and landing pages.
- Use consistent templates for course intros, lessons, and quizzes.
- Reuse content blocks like instructor bios, FAQ, and testimonials with consistent styles.
- Keep templates modular so you can update design globally.
Emails, notifications, and transactional branding
Email is a primary point of contact with learners. Customizing email templates and sender details keeps your communications consistent.
Setting sender name and email address
Use a recognizable sender name (e.g., “Your Academy Team”) and a domain-based email address (e.g., noreply@yourdomain.com).
- Authenticate email with SPF, DKIM, and DMARC to improve deliverability.
- Use a support email for replies, and avoid generic free providers for main notices.
Custom email templates and design
Modify subject lines, headers, footers, and body styles to reflect your tone and visual identity.
- Ensure templates work on major email clients and mobile devices.
- Use concise, action-driven copy for transactional emails (registration, password reset, receipts).
- Test with seed accounts and inbox providers to ensure delivery.
Notification rules and language
You can control which events trigger emails and customize their language.
- Internationalize templates if you support multiple languages.
- Offer preferences for notification frequency to reduce churn from excessive emails.
Certificates, receipts, and downloadable assets
Your certifications and receipts are brand collateral that learners often share. Ensure they reflect your identity.
Creating branded certificates
Customize templates to include your logo, signature, color scheme, and legal text.
- Use high-resolution imagery to ensure printable quality.
- Insert dynamic fields for learner name, course title, date, and ID number.
- Consider embedding a verification URL or QR code for authenticity.
Receipts and invoices
Receipts must include your company information and tax details.
- Set clear invoice numbering and include VAT/GST details where required.
- Provide downloadable PDF receipts compatible with accounting systems.
SEO, metadata, and social sharing
Branding extends to how your pages appear in search results and social feeds. Proper metadata increases click-through rates and brand visibility.
Page titles and meta descriptions
Write clear, keyword-focused titles and compelling meta descriptions for sales pages and courses.
- Include your brand name for recognition and authority.
- Keep titles readable and descriptions within typical character limits.
Open Graph and Twitter Cards
Ensure pages display correctly when shared on social platforms by specifying OG tags and Twitter meta tags.
- Include image dimensions and use a branded thumbnail for course pages.
- Test shares using platform debugging tools to confirm appearance.
URL structure and slugs
Use readable, SEO-friendly URLs that include course names and categories.
- Avoid excessive query strings for content pages.
- Ensure redirects are in place if you rename or remove pages.
Integrations and tracking for brand analytics
You need visibility into how your branded experience performs. Integrations collect critical data and keep your marketing stack cohesive.
Analytics platforms
Set up Google Analytics 4 or other analytics tools to track pageviews, conversions, and user journeys.
- Configure events for course enrollments, lesson completion, and certificate issuance.
- Use UTM parameters for campaign tracking.
Tag managers and pixels
Implement Google Tag Manager or similar to manage marketing tags without frequent code deployments.
- Install Facebook/Meta and LinkedIn pixels for retargeting campaigns.
- Respect privacy laws and allow users to opt out of tracking.
CRM and marketing automation
Connect LearnWorlds to your CRM to sync user profiles, purchases, and learning progress.
- Use Zapier, native integrations, or APIs to automate lead nurturing and onboarding.
- Map data fields clearly to avoid duplicate records and sync errors.
Payments, billing, and checkout experience
The checkout is a pivotal moment for conversion. Make it familiar and secure by matching visual branding and simplifying the flow.
Branded checkout pages
Use your brand colors and logos on checkout forms, and avoid surprising fees or steps.
- Display trust indicators like SSL and accepted payment logos.
- Offer multiple payment methods and local currencies where possible.
Receipts and subscription branding
Branded receipts reinforce the purchase as part of your product offering. For subscriptions, clearly communicate renewal terms.
- Provide self-service billing management in the account area.
- Notify users before renewals and failed payments.
Tax and compliance
Ensure tax handling and invoicing comply with regional laws, especially for cross-border sales of digital goods.
- Use tax IDs and VAT/GST collection where applicable.
- Consider integrated tax services if you have global learners.
Legal pages and privacy controls
Branding includes clear legal pathways and consistent customer trust signals.
Privacy policy and terms
Host up-to-date privacy and terms pages branded to your company and linked in the footer and during checkout.
- Review policies with legal counsel for course content and data processing specifics.
- Describe how learner data is stored, used, and shared.
Consent and cookie management
Comply with GDPR, CCPA, and other privacy laws by offering cookie consent and data requests.
- Include a cookie banner that reflects your brand tone and color.
- Provide easy mechanisms for learners to request data deletion or export.
Accessibility and performance considerations
A branded experience must be usable by everyone and load quickly to maintain trust.
Accessibility practices
Apply WCAG guidelines for color contrast, keyboard navigation, and screen reader compatibility.
- Ensure form labels, alt text, and ARIA attributes are present and descriptive.
- Test with assistive technologies and conduct user testing with diverse learners.
Performance optimization
Slow pages reduce conversions and reflect poorly on brand quality.
- Compress images, use lazy loading, and minimize third-party scripts.
- Monitor Core Web Vitals and implement caching strategies.
Advanced customization: API and developer options
When built-in settings aren’t enough, developer tools enable more complex customizations that maintain brand fidelity.
LearnWorlds API usage
APIs allow you to automate user provisioning, sync progress, fetch reports, and integrate deeply with your systems.
- Authenticate securely and follow rate limits.
- Use API logging and retries for resilient workflows.
Webhooks and event-driven automation
Webhooks notify your systems in real time about enrollments, payments, and completions.
- Use webhooks to trigger onboarding emails, access control, or CRM updates.
- Secure webhook endpoints with validation tokens and IP whitelisting.
Using hosted site templates and custom pages
You can host landing pages and marketing sites outside LearnWorlds and still integrate enrollment flows to maintain full control over promotional branding.
- Use consistent CSS and shared asset hosting to keep experience seamless.
- Redirect or embed enrollment forms when needed.
Plan limitations and selection for full white labeling
Not all LearnWorlds plans include every white-label feature. Choosing the correct plan affects what you can customize.
Feature availability by plan
Different plans unlock domain mapping, advanced CSS/JS, removing platform branding, and API access. Select a plan that meets your customization and scalability needs.
- Confirm whether the plan supports single sign-on (SSO) if you need enterprise integrations.
- Check certificate branding, priority support, and integrations included per tier.
(See example table for typical plan differences.)
Feature | Basic/Starter | Pro/Advanced | White-Label/Enterprise |
---|---|---|---|
Custom domain | Limited | Yes | Yes |
Remove platform branding | No | Partial | Yes |
Custom CSS/JS | No | Yes | Yes |
API & Webhooks | No | Yes | Yes |
SSO | No | Optional | Yes |
Priority support | No | Optional | Yes |
Common pitfalls and how you mitigate them
Anticipate issues so you can proactively address them during implementation.
Broken CSS and theme conflicts
Unscoped CSS can override platform scripts or break mobile layouts.
- Scope your styles to containers or use prefix classes.
- Test changes in staging and multiple devices.
Mixed content and insecure assets
Embedding HTTP assets on an HTTPS site causes browser blocks or warnings.
- Serve all assets via HTTPS.
- Replace old embeds or host media in secure CDNs.
Performance degradation from third-party scripts
Marketing tags and chat widgets can slow load times.
- Load non-essential scripts asynchronously.
- Use tag manager rules to fire tags only on required pages.
Launch checklist for a fully branded LearnWorlds site
Follow a structured checklist to ensure nothing is missed before public launch.
Task | Done | Notes |
---|---|---|
Setup custom domain and SSL | [ ] | Confirm DNS propagation |
Upload logos, favicon, and brand assets | [ ] | Optimize file sizes |
Configure brand colors and fonts | [ ] | Accessibility checks |
Customize header, footer, and navigation | [ ] | Legal links present |
Configure email sender and templates | [ ] | SPF/DKIM/DMARC set |
Customize course player and CSS | [ ] | Test on devices |
Setup analytics, pixels, and GTM | [ ] | Map events to conversions |
Integrate CRM and payment gateways | [ ] | Test transactions |
Create certificates and receipts | [ ] | Include verification |
Run QA and accessibility testing | [ ] | Real user tests |
Prepare rollback and version control | [ ] | Backup custom code |
Best practices for ongoing brand consistency
Consistent maintenance ensures your brand remains polished over time.
- Maintain a style guide for colors, fonts, and copy tone.
- Use version control for any custom code and change logs for content updates.
- Schedule periodic audits for SEO, privacy compliance, accessibility, and performance.
Practical examples and use cases
These examples show how different organizations use white labeling to support goals.
Course creators and instructors
You present professional course catalogs that match marketing materials, increasing perceived value and enabling higher pricing.
- Use branded certificates for trust and social proof.
- Integrate email sequences for onboarding and upselling.
Corporations and training departments
You provide a centralized training portal under your company domain for employees and partners.
- Use SSO for seamless access.
- Track compliance with reporting and API integrations.
Membership and subscription businesses
You deliver a recurring value proposition through a branded academy with subscriber-only content.
- Use anticipation tactics (teasers, drip schedules) within branded templates.
- Manage retention through targeted email automation.
Testing, monitoring, and iteration
Successful branding is iterative. Test before launch and continuously improve with data.
- A/B test landing pages and checkout flow to refine messaging and conversion rates.
- Use session recordings and heatmaps to observe learner behavior and friction points.
- Monitor support metrics and learner feedback to prioritize updates.
When to engage technical or design partners
Complex branding needs or enterprise requirements may require professionals.
- Hire front-end developers for advanced CSS/JS and API work.
- Use UX designers to craft high-conversion course and checkout flows.
- Work with legal counsel for compliance on certificates, taxes, and data.
Final recommendations and next steps
Prioritize the fundamentals—custom domain, SSL, logos, and emails—then layer in player, templates, and API integrations. Test thoroughly and maintain a style guide to ensure your LearnWorlds site continues to represent your brand consistently.
If you follow the steps and best practices outlined here, you can deliver a fully branded, professional learning experience that aligns with your business goals and elevates learner trust and engagement.